Think of each webpage content as having a part in helping you achieve your goals

Now you have a goal you can make sure that everything you do in your business is channelled to help you achieve it. And that includes your website and SEO.

Think of each page on your website as having a part in helping you achieve your business goals.

Questions to ask your website page:

  • How do you help me achieve [insert goal here]?
  • What do my customers want when they arrive on this page (intent)?
  • How can I use the intent of my customers on this page to achieve my goals?
  • What do I need to do to get this page to help me achieve my goals?


How to get website pages to achieve your goals

  • Create a compelling call to action
  • Link to other pages on your site with useful information that can add value
  • Write it from your clients point of view, so they’re engaged and read on
  • Make it clear and simple to understand

Have an SEO plan for each page

Now you know what you want your page to achieve it’s time to create an SEO plan for each page.

Start by creating a Google Sheet or Excel Spreadsheet. Then make one new sheet for each website page. 

On each page have a column that shows:

  • How do you help me achieve [insert goal here]?
  • What do my customers want when they arrive on this page?
  • What keywords/phrases would people enter into the search engines when they want to find the information on this page?
  • What are similar words (synonyms) that they might search for?
  • What do you want them to do when they’ve finished on this page?

Put your SEO content plan into action

Make sure you make time to update the word on your webpage so it reflects the intent and keywords you have on your SEO Spreadsheet of Awesomeness.

Write for humans first NOT SEO algorithms. Make it clear and easy to read and understand. Keep it focused on your customer and addressing their problems and needs.
